
The Corporación de Exportadores de El Salvador (COEXPORT) announced the launch of the fifth edition of its Operadores Confiablescertification support program, an initiative that seeks to strengthen the competitiveness of salvadoran companies by adopting international standards for security, compliance, and trade facilitation.
According to the organization, this new edition will provide support to 20 companies in the export, import, and logistics sectors interested in obtaining Operadores Confiables Certification, granted by the Dirección General de Aduanas de El Salvador.
The program aims to prepare companies to meet the certification requirements through technical assistance and specialized guidance in areas related to supply chain security, risk management, and compliance with customs processes.

Trusted Operator certification is a recognition awarded to companies that demonstrate high levels of compliance with customs regulations and maintain security controls in their international trade operations. This mechanism is part of the efforts to streamline trade and strengthen trust between customs authorities and the private sector.
During the program’s presentation, Luis Córdova, advisor to the Dirección General de Aduanas de El Salvador. explained to participants some of the main benefits that certified companies receive.
Among the advantages is the reduction of physical inspections of goods, which allows for decreased time and costs associated with export and import processes. Companies also have access to priority attention in customs procedures, facilitating more efficient management of their business operations.

Another benefit is the assignment of specialized account executives who provide support and personalized attention to matters related to customs procedures. Furthermore, certified companies can use non-intrusive controls for verifying goods, reducing the need for traditional physical inspections.
Certification also allows access to faster clearance processes, which contributes to improved logistics efficiency and strengthens companies’ competitiveness in international markets.
